NTP introduces Penta 725 router and RCCoreV3 software to Middle East broadcasters at CABSAT 2010. Meet NTP on stand LB-1
12-01-2010

Two new additions to the NTP Technology range of digital audio routers and control software will be introduced to Middle East broadcasters at CABSAT 2010, Dubai, March 2-4. Exhibiting on stand LB-1, NTP will demonstrate the new Penta 725 compact modular audio router and RCCoreV3 configuration-and-control software.

"The Penta 725 series is a new-generation compact modular audio router designed for sound recording studios, post-production facilities and mobile production vehicles, as well as television and radio broadcasting. It accommodates up to 384 x 384 crosspoints in a compact 1 U 19 inch chassis. 64 AES3 stereo and four MADI inputs/outputs can be accessed for interfacing digital audio sources. Controllable via TCP/IP or front-panel navigation keys, the Penta 725 accommodates a variety of software modules. Two high-speed bi-directional links are included for connection to NTP 625 or additional Penta 725 systems. An AES3 monitor output is provided for input and output monitoring. The compactness of the Penta 725 will be particularly appreciated by system integrators seeking to achieve maximum space-efficiency."

"Our new RCCore software, first demonstrated at IBC2009, allows configuration, control and supervision of all router modules in an NTP audio signal distribution system. RCCoreV3 can be used as a stand-alone controller within the NTP 635-300 router or run from standard PC hardware. It provides highly efficient control of the router's dual-backbone interface and supports the double-LAN interface on 625-800 frames. RCCoreV3 also forms a communication interface to the NTP VMC and BLISS control options and to third-party communication protocols. Features include remote access and log-in at expert-user level for system set-up, maintenance and database management. Secure access is possible via Virtual Private Network. A retro-compatible plug-and-play database can be held on the active controller and on standby controllers."

The NTP Penta 725 compact modular audio router and RCCoreV3 control application are available now
